Baltic IT&T 2006 Forum: eBaltics

The annual Baltic IT&T 2006 conference is one of the most important IT&T forums in the Baltic Sea region, and major subjects this year were eInclusion, eHealth and eGovernment. The forum has brought together senior government representatives from the Baltic Sea region and other countries, high level officials and experts from European Commission and international organisations, information society leaders and chief researchers, as well as CEO's and top level executives from ICT companies and other high-ranking delegates. Altogether almost 600 delegates participated at different Forum events (including IST4Balt Workshop Towards a Knowledge Society). They represented 27 countries Austria, Belarus, Belgium, Canada, the Czech Republic, Denmark, Estonia, Finland, France, Germany, Greece, Hungary, Iceland, Italy, Latvia, Lithuania, the Netherlands, Norway, Poland, Portugal, Russia, Slovakia, South Africa, Spain, Sweden, Switzerland, and the United Kingdom. The event was organised by the Latvian Information and Communications Technology Association (LIKTA) and Data Media Group. The Honorary chairman for the event was the Prime Minister of Latvia, Aigars Kalvtis. The motto of the forum was Building Effective Partnership Networks. All of the forum materials, presentations, events and related publications can be found at www.ebaltics.com. Planning is underway already for the Baltic IT&T 2007 Forum: eBaltics.
